Keep reading \u2013 we\u2019ll tell you what to do!<\/p>\n\n\n\n<!--more-->\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Immediate Dental First Aid Tips<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>If your summer vacations tend to be active, the first type of dental emergency you probably thought of is dental damage. Losing or chipping a tooth will certainly disrupt an outing, but don\u2019t panic! Follow these first aid guidelines while you look for an emergency dentist: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>If you can find the knocked-out tooth or dental fragment, <strong>handle it gently<\/strong>, avoiding the roots.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Wash the salvaged piece<\/strong> in slow-running, temperate tap water.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>However, don\u2019t wrap it up or expose it to water for a prolonged period. Instead, keep it moist in a <strong>bag of spit<\/strong> or <strong>cup of milk<\/strong>.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Don\u2019t forget to <strong>staunch any bleeding<\/strong> with a soft tissue or cloth.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Give the poor soul who got hurt <strong>painkillers<\/strong> or a <strong>cold compress<\/strong> for swelling.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>Ensuring any supplies you might need are all in one place will help first aid go smoother. It\u2019s a good idea to pack a to-go dental emergency kit for your travels!<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Prevent Dental Disaster with Preventative Care<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Dental emergencies don\u2019t just include accidental injuries. Conditions like tooth decay and gum disease can cause just as much chaos. Don\u2019t let a sudden toothache or oral pain catch you by surprise! Instead, be sure to visit your dentist for a checkup and cleaning before you leave. They\u2019ll make sure everyone\u2019s pearly whites are healthy and ready for some uninterrupted fun in the sun.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Trust the Local Emergency Dentist<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>No matter what type of dental emergency you might be faced with, you should see an emergency dentist as soon as possible.
